About M. Morera

M. Morera is a scholar working on Health, Toxicology and Mutagenesis, Epidemiology, Nutrition and Dietetics, Food Science and Infectious Diseases, having authored 15 papers that have together received 570 indexed citations. Recurring topics across this work include Mercury impact and mitigation studies (3 papers), Pneumonia and Respiratory Infections (3 papers), Antibiotic Use and Resistance (2 papers), Bacterial Infections and Vaccines (2 papers), Gut microbiota and health (2 papers), Probiotics and Fermented Foods (2 papers), Heavy Metal Exposure and Toxicity (2 papers) and Heavy metals in environment (2 papers). The work is most often cited by research in Applied Microbiology and Biotechnology (66 citations), Molecular Medicine (65 citations), Microbiology (71 citations), Health, Toxicology and Mutagenesis (133 citations) and Critical Care and Intensive Care Medicine (37 citations). M. Morera has collaborated with scholars based in Spain, Belgium and France. Frequent co-authors include Carola Sanpera, Lluís Jover, X. Ruiz, F. Bella, Javier Garau, D. Fontanals, S. Crespo, J. M. Nava, Josep Lite and V. Pineda. Their work appears in journals such as Clinical Infectious Diseases, Archives of Environmental Contamination and Toxicology, European Journal of Clinical Microbiology & Infectious Diseases, Bulletin of Environmental Contamination and Toxicology and Frontiers in Pediatrics.
